Laptops to check out?

  • In library 4-hour use:
    • Located at main desk on 1st floor
    • Must have own SVSU ID
      • No ID, no laptop, no exceptions!
    • You will fill out a form with your name, ID number, email, and sign the form
    • Laptops have a four hour check out
    • Laptops must stay in the library
  • Semester long checkout:
    • Fill out an IT ticket
    • An email will immediately be sent saying a ticket has been created.
    • Wait for the second email.
    • Copy and paste link to book an appointment to pick up the laptop.
    • Bring your student ID!
    • Must book an appointment to return equipment at end of semester as well.
